oracle 如何备份数据库
什么是Oracle备份?
Oracle备份是指将Oracle数据库中的数据和元数据进行复制,以防止数据丢失或系统出现故障时进行恢复。备份可以是全备份、增量备份或差异备份,全备份包含整个数据库,而增量备份和差异备份仅包含上次备份后发生的更改。
如何备份Oracle数据库?
有多种方法可以备份Oracle数据库,包括使用RMAN(Recovery Manager)命令、使用Export/Import命令,以及使用Oracle Data Pump等工具。使用RMAN可以备份整个数据库,包括控制文件、已归档日志文件和数据文件。在备份完成后,可以使用RMAN进行恢复数据库操作。
备份Oracle数据库的最佳实践
备份Oracle数据库的最佳实践是定期备份,并将备份存储在另一台服务器上或外部存储设备上,以防止本地备份和存储设备出现问题。此外,应使用不同的备份方式来保护数据和元数据。例如,可以使用全备份和增量备份进行组合。
如何优化Oracle备份?
为了优化Oracle备份,可以采用一些方法:首先,将备份操作分散到不同时间段,以避免备份操作在重要的业务时间内影响性能。其次,应使用多个备份目标设备,对备份文件进行分散存储,以避免单个备份设备失效。最后,应优化磁盘I/O、网络和存储设备的性能,以提高备份和恢复操作的速度。
备份Oracle数据库的注意事项
备份Oracle数据库时需要注意以下事项:首先,备份操作应确认数据库是否已备份完成。其次,在备份过程中,应禁用Oracle的自动备份功能,以防止冲突。最后,在数据库中有大量数据变更时,应使用增量备份而不是全备份,以减少备份和恢复操作的时间。